Which set of numbers is the most reasonable to describe the temperature in alaska during the winter?
A. Integers
B.whole numbers
C. Irrational numbers
D.natural numbers

technically, since temperature is a continuous quantity, only real numbers can adequately express any temperature.
However, most of the time, it is reported without going into partial degrees, like 20° or -15°
So, which set of numbers would that be?
